Best answer: How do you display the last line of a text file in Unix?

Norėdami peržiūrėti kelias paskutines failo eilutes, naudokite komandą tail. tail veikia taip pat, kaip head: įveskite tail ir failo pavadinimą, kad pamatytumėte paskutines 10 to failo eilučių, arba įveskite tail -number failo pavadinimas, kad pamatytumėte paskutines failo skaičių eilutes.

Kaip pamatyti paskutines 10 failo eilučių Unix?

Linux uodegos komandų sintaksė

Tail yra komanda, kuri išspausdina keletą paskutinių tam tikro failo eilučių (pagal nutylėjimą 10 eilučių) ir baigia. 1 pavyzdys: Pagal numatytuosius nustatymus „uodega“ išspausdina paskutines 10 failo eilučių, tada išeina. kaip matote, tai išspausdina paskutines 10 /var/log/messages eilučių.

Kaip gauti paskutines 100 failo eilučių naudojant Unix?

Uodegos komanda yra komandų eilutės programa, skirta paskutinę failų dalį, pateiktą jai naudojant standartinę įvestį, išvesti. Jis įrašo rezultatus į standartinę išvestį. Pagal numatytuosius nustatymus uodega grąžina paskutines dešimt kiekvieno jam pateikto failo eilučių. Jis taip pat gali būti naudojamas sekti failą realiuoju laiku ir stebėti, kaip į jį įrašomos naujos eilutės.

Kaip rodyti eilutę iš tekstinio failo „Linux“?

Kaip rodyti konkrečias failo eilutes Linux komandinėje eilutėje

  1. Rodyti konkrečias eilutes naudodami galvos ir uodegos komandas. Spausdinkite vieną konkrečią eilutę. Spausdinkite tam tikrą eilučių diapazoną.
  2. Norėdami rodyti konkrečias eilutes, naudokite SED.
  3. Norėdami spausdinti konkrečias eilutes iš failo, naudokite AWK.

2 rugpj 2020

Kaip peržiūrėti failo pabaigą „Linux“?

Uodegos komanda yra pagrindinė „Linux“ programa, naudojama tekstinių failų pabaigai peržiūrėti. Taip pat galite naudoti sekimo režimą, kad pamatytumėte naujas eilutes, kai jos pridedamos prie failo realiuoju laiku. uodega yra panaši į head įrankį, naudojamą failų pradžiai peržiūrėti.

Kaip Unix sistemoje parodyti kelias pirmąsias failo eilutes?

Įveskite šią antraštės komandą, kad būtų rodomos pirmosios 10 failo „bar.txt“ eilučių:

  1. galva -10 bar.txt.
  2. galva -20 bar.txt.
  3. sed -n 1,10p /etc/group.
  4. sed -n 1,20p /etc/group.
  5. awk 'FNR <= 10' /etc/passwd.
  6. awk 'FNR <= 20' /etc/passwd.
  7. perl -ne'1..10 ir print' /etc/passwd.
  8. perl -ne'1..20 ir print' /etc/passwd.

18 Lt. 2018 m.

Kaip parodyti paskutinę failo eilutę?

Norėdami peržiūrėti kelias paskutines failo eilutes, naudokite komandą tail. tail veikia taip pat, kaip head: įveskite tail ir failo pavadinimą, kad pamatytumėte paskutines 10 to failo eilučių, arba įveskite tail -number failo pavadinimas, kad pamatytumėte paskutines failo skaičių eilutes. Pabandykite naudoti uodegą, kad pažiūrėtumėte į paskutines penkias savo eilutes.

Koks yra simbolių ir eilučių skaičiaus faile skaičiavimo procesas?

Komanda „wc“ iš esmės reiškia „žodžių skaičius“, o naudojant skirtingus pasirenkamus parametrus galima suskaičiuoti eilučių, žodžių ir simbolių skaičių tekstiniame faile. Naudodami wc be parinkčių gausite baitų, eilučių ir žodžių skaičių (parinktis -c, -l ir -w).

Kuri komanda naudojama failams palyginti?

Kuri komanda naudojama failų skirtumams parodyti? Paaiškinimas: komanda diff naudojama failams lyginti ir jų skirtumams parodyti.

Kokia komanda efektyviausia identifikuojant įvairių tipų failus?

Apskaičiuokite Kainą

Kokią komandą galima duoti norint patvirtinti, kokiame kataloge esate komandinės eilutės eilutėje? pwd
Kokia komanda efektyviausia identifikuojant įvairių tipų failus? Failo komanda
Kokiu režimu vi redaktorius atidaromas pagal numatytuosius nustatymus? komanda

Kaip Unix sistemoje pereiti į failo eilutę?

Jei jau esate vi, galite naudoti komandą goto. Norėdami tai padaryti, paspauskite Esc , įveskite eilutės numerį ir paspauskite Shift-g . Jei paspausite Esc ir Shift-g nenurodydami eilutės numerio, būsite nukreipti į paskutinę failo eilutę.

Kaip Unix faile parodyti eilučių skaičių?

Kaip suskaičiuoti eilutes faile UNIX/Linux

  1. Komanda „wc -l“, kai vykdoma šiame faile, išveda eilučių skaičių kartu su failo pavadinimu. $ wc -l failas01.txt 5 failas01.txt.
  2. Norėdami praleisti failo pavadinimą rezultate, naudokite: $ wc -l < ​​file01.txt 5.
  3. Komandos išvestį visada galite pateikti wc komandai naudodami vamzdį. Pavyzdžiui:

Kaip rodyti n-ąją failo eilutę Unix?

Žemiau yra trys puikūs būdai gauti n-ąją failo eilutę sistemoje „Linux“.

  1. galva / uodega. Paprasčiausias galvos ir uodegos komandų derinys tikriausiai yra lengviausias būdas. …
  2. sed. Yra keletas puikių būdų tai padaryti naudojant sed. …
  3. awk. awk turi integruotą kintamąjį NR, kuris seka failų / srautų eilučių numerius.

Kaip sugrąžinti paskutinę failo eilutę „Linux“?

Galite tai traktuoti kaip lentelę, kurioje pirmasis stulpelis yra failo pavadinimas, o antrasis yra atitiktis, kur stulpelių skyriklis yra simbolis „:“. Gaukite paskutinę kiekvieno failo eilutę (priešdėlis su failo pavadinimu). Tada filtruokite išvestį pagal modelį. Alternatyva gali būti padaryta naudojant awk, o ne grep.

Kuri komanda vadinama failo pabaigos komanda?

EOF reiškia failo pabaigą. „EOF suaktyvinimas“ šiuo atveju apytiksliai reiškia „programos informavimą, kad daugiau nebus siunčiama įvestis“.

Kaip peržiūrėti žurnalo failą?

Kadangi dauguma žurnalo failų įrašomi paprastu tekstu, jį atidaryti puikiai tiks naudojant bet kurią teksto rengyklę. Pagal numatytuosius nustatymus „Windows“ naudos „Notepad“, kad atidarytų LOG failą, kai jį dukart spustelėsite. Beveik neabejotinai sistemoje jau yra įdiegta arba įdiegta programa, skirta atidaryti LOG failus.

Patinka šis įrašas? Prašau pasidalinti su draugais:
OS šiandien